WebFor instance, the cuttings from the grass undergo a chemical change because they will decompose. Once the grass cuttings have decomposed back into the soil, they are no longer grass. They become nutrients for other organisms but they can not be put back together to form grass. If you burn the grass cuttings, this is also a chemical change.
